Abstract

A first optical device is adapted to couple to a second optical device along a coupling direction and includes two spaced apart pairs of leading and trailing pads, such that when the first optical device lands and slides on a landing surface of the second optical device to optically couple to the second optical device, and for each pair of leading and trailing pads, the leading pad prevents any debris on the landing surface from collecting on the trailing pad. Upon full coupling of the first optical device with the second optical device, the leading pads do not make contact with the landing surface. The first optical device may be, for example, an optical ferrule or a cradle having a recess adapted to receive an optical ferrule.
